Welcome to Quillport Studios!

Lockers in the changing rooms are first come, first served, but please grab one on your first day and stick a name card on it — spares are at the front desk. Lockers open with the same reader as the main doors. To pair your locker, tap your badge and key in the code below.

staff pass of kawip-hawef = bdg-QLP-2

## Watchdog basics

Every Corvid kiosk runs the Perchkeeper watchdog, which restarts the shell app if the heartbeat file goes stale for 90 seconds. Contractors only need to touch its env file when imaging a new unit: set `WATCHDOG_INTERVAL` and `KIOSK_SITE_CODE` per the site sheet. The watchdog also reports upstream, and its reporting credential is set on the following line.

vault entry, yahif-yajep: COURIER_KEY29=b802bdf8034096b65a51c6ba5abe2

## Ticket: Rebalancer pods crash-looping in staging

Pedalflow's rebalancing tool fails on boot with `auth: missing credential`. Root cause: the staging env file was copied from the demo cluster and lacks the dock-telemetry secret, so the dispatcher can't pull station fill levels.

Fix: edit `/opt/pedalflow/.env`, confirm `PF_REGION=staging-west`, then append the telemetry credential on the line below:

env line for fafof-fahag: LEDGER_TOKEN5=f8790

Quick note on the vendor side of things: the translation-string extraction script (internally called Stringcomb) is maintained under contract by the Verdala localization shop. They handle the parser itself; we own the glossary files and the CI hook. If extraction output looks off, check the glossary before blaming the script. Anything that needs a fix on their end, route it through their liaison here.

billing contact of yawip-yadup = druath.casdor@nelvrolabs.internal

Leadership Review Briefing — Warranty-Cost Overrun

For the sales leads: warranty claims on the Ostrel pump series ran 38% above forecast this quarter, driven by a seal defect in units built at Harwick. Remediation is funded, and revised claim projections are attached. Please align customer messaging with the guidance herein. The confidential planning note for this review sits directly below.

internal memo for tadup-hahag: Project Feniel slips by six weeks because of the audit delay.